yii中文亂碼的解決方法:首先找到資料庫設定檔;然後修改程式碼語句為“'dsn' => 'mysql:host=127.0.0.1; dbname=ohmycto; charset=utf8',” ;最後保存修改即可。
關於yii2的中文亂碼問題
推薦:《yii教學》
在資料庫設定中這麼配就可以了
<?php return [ 'class' => 'yii\db\Connection', 'dsn' => 'mysql:host=127.0.0.1; dbname=ohmycto; charset=utf8', 'username' => 'website', 'password' => 'mengde1B', ];
簡單總結:
如果是資料庫輸出來是亂碼,建議修改一下本機設定資料時候的字元集為'charset' => 'utf8mb4',或'charset' => 'utf8',如果是頁面有問題,可能是你那一頁字元編碼有問題,Yii2 預設的就是UTF-8 的。
以上是yii中文亂碼怎麼解決的詳細內容。更多資訊請關注PHP中文網其他相關文章!